sleepingv.

1.[i](+ adv./prep.)to rest with your eyes closed and your mind and body not active

to sleep well/deeply/soundly/badly

I couldn't sleep because of the noise.

I had to sleep on the sofa.

He slept solidly for ten hours.

I slept at my sister's house last night(= stayed the night there) .

We both slept right through(= were not woken up by) the storm.

She only sleeps for four hours a night.

We sometimes sleep late at the weekends(= until late in the morning) .

I put the sleeping baby down gently.

What are our sleeping arrangements here(= where shall we sleep) ?

2.[t][nopass]~ sb宿to have enough beds for a particular number of people

The apartment sleeps six.

The hotel sleeps 120 guests. 120 宿

n.

1.[u]the natural state of rest in which your eyes are closed, your body is not active, and your mind is not conscious

I need to get some sleep .

I didn't get much sleep last night.

Can you give me something to help me get to sleep(= start sleeping) ?西

Go to sleep ─it's late./ target=_blank class=infotextkey>

He cried out in his sleep .

Anxiety can be caused by lack of sleep .

His talk nearly sent me to sleep(= it was boring) .

Try to go back to sleep ./ target=_blank class=infotextkey>

2.[sing]a period of sleep

Did you have a good sleep?

Ros fell into a deep sleep.

I'll feel better after a good night's sleep(= a night when I sleep well) .

v.1.to go into a natural state in which you are unconscious for a time and your body rests, especially for several hours at night2.to have enough room or beds for a particular number of people to sleep in3.if a place or building sleeps, all the people who live there are sleeping, especially at night

n.1.a natural state in which you are unconscious for a time and your body rests, especially for several hours at night2.a period of time when you are sleeping3.a substance that forms in the corner of your eyes when you are sleeping
